Crescent Communities closed on a parcel of land for NOVEL Norterra, a new four-story multifamily community planned in northern Phoenix, Arizona. Situated on an 8.5-acre site just east of I-17 in the Norterra neighborhood, the development will include 248 for-rent residences near the TSMC Arizona semiconductor manufacturing complex, retail, and outdoor destinations. The latest agreement between Gleeson Homes and Lloyds Living will deliver another 104 private rental homes across two developments in the Midlands. The properties will be built at Hollinwell Heath in Kirkby-in-Ashfield and Watermills in Apedale, near Newcastle-under-Lyme, with a mixture of two, three and four-bedroom houses intended to appeal mainly to couples and families….
